Gilberdyke station is straightforward with its facilities. A ticket office isn't available, but thankfully, one doesn't have to look far to find ticket machines for collecting pre-purchased tickets. Accessible ticket machines can be found on Platform 1, ensuring ease of use for all travelers. If you are planning your trip online, you can smoothly collect your tickets from these machines.
No staff assistance is available on-site, but the station is equipped to support passengers with hearing impairments thanks to an induction loop system. For travelers requiring assistance, help is only a call away via the national helpline. It should be noted that Gilberdyke station lacks extensive amenities such as waiting rooms, a seating area, toilets, and refreshment facilities.
In terms of accessibility, the station offers step-free access in certain areas. However, platform access relies on a footbridge, posing limitations for wheelchair users. Should you require help with boarding, conductors are available to assist with the use of ramps.
Connecting to onward travel from Gilberdyke is straightforward. Taxi services can be easily arranged through Cab4You. For bus enthusiasts, information to plan your journey is conveniently available in a printable format here. For any rail disruptions, a rail replacement bus service is outlined to pick up or drop off passengers by Station Road.

Although Ruabon station lacks a formal ticket office, it features ticket machines for purchasing and collecting pre-bought online tickets. These machines accept major debit and credit cards but won't take cash. For those requiring audio assistance, an induction loop is available, ensuring that the station remains accessible to everyone.
There are no car parking charges; despite its modest size, the station offers 35 car parking spaces, of which 4 are accessible. However, CCTV is not available in the car park. It’s worth noting that while the station offers step-free access in parts, reaching Platform 1 involves a footbridge with 52 steps, potentially challenging for travelers with heavy luggage or mobility issues. Step-free access is available to Platform 2, serving those heading to Wrexham.
Connectivity is not an issue at Ruabon, thanks to an array of transport options. If rail services face an issue, a rail replacement bus stop is conveniently located near the station entrance, ensuring travelers can continue their journey with minimal disruption. For those who prefer buses, the station is only 100 yards from Wrexham & Ruabon PlusBus services. This service provides unlimited bus travel at discounted rates—an advantageous option for frequent travelers.
Additionally, taxi services are readily available around the station, making quick drop-offs and pick-ups a hassle-free experience.
